Output 931289005c3ee3642cfa434736fa94fe21f74e84152365f5e9802aee58859a8d:1

value
304569
script pubkey
OP_0 OP_PUSHBYTES_20 deb23e24348387c4411971ebe55ba57af8d5d0df
address
bc1qm6erufp5swrugsgew8472ka90tudt5xl0zecck
transaction
931289005c3ee3642cfa434736fa94fe21f74e84152365f5e9802aee58859a8d
spent
true